Connecting Google Home to Wi-Fi
To connect the Google Home with your preferred Wi-Fi network, you need to use your android/iOS device. Connect your phone with the Wi-Fi before jumping to the process. Follow all the steps accordingly to confirm a successful connection. Here you go.
- Plugin the “Power cable” to turn on the “Google Home” device. Wait for a few seconds, and Google Home will welcome you with a voice notification.
- Take your phone and go to the “Play Store.” Open the “App Store” in the case of iOS. Make sure it’s connected to the Wi-Fi.
- Search for “Google Home” in the search bar and get the “Google Home” app.
- Open the application. The application will detect the “Google Home” device.
- Click on “Get Started,” and it’ll take you to the next page. Now, go with the “Set a new device” option.
- Check the “Create Home” option and hit “Next”.
- A new page will open asking for “Nickname” and “Address.” Fill in the blanks and hit “Next” to open the next page.
- The “Google Home” will beep. A notification will appear asking, “Heard a sound?” Tap “Yes” to continue.
- Now, select “I agree” to the legal terms notification. Go on selecting the further options according to your choice.
- Choose the “Wi-Fi network” and hit “Next.” Enter your Wi-Fi passcode to connect.
- After a few seconds, you will see a “Connected” notification on your phone screen.
- Tap “Next” for Google Assistant settings. Choose “I agree” for the next few options.
- Choose your desired “Services” on Google Home and finish the process by tapping “Next”.
- Google Home will be connected to the Wi-Fi through your phone.
How to Connect the Google Home to a New Wi-Fi?
Here is how you can switch to a new network with your Google Home.
- Go to your phone “Settings.” Scroll down the notification bar to go to “Settings.” Else, you can open the “Settings” application from the application section.
- Type “Wi-Fi” on the search option and open it.
- You will see the old network is still connected to your device. Tap on it and select “Forget this Network.” This network will be removed from your device.
- Now, go back and select the new network. Tap on it and enter the password. The new network will get connected.
- Now, open the “Google Home” application and select any tab from there.
- Touch the “Settings” icon from the top right of your phone screen.
- Scroll down and choose “Wi-Fi.” You will see the old network there. Tap on it and touch “forget this network.” Now, close the application.
- Now, open the “Google Home” application again and follow the Wi-Fi connection process included above. And if you know that already, do it yourself.
